Output 6f86409859bb8ee3897c78ad3402680bd455469230c707479ba9028b8bbfde6e:0

value
401423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8854adbc6dd4af9ebb26c88aa16b4af0244219b OP_EQUAL
address
3JWfwAERP1C7mrvuv64MznSr7J4pQivEZS
transaction
6f86409859bb8ee3897c78ad3402680bd455469230c707479ba9028b8bbfde6e
confirmations
303743
spent
true